wa-innaka
And indeed you
CONJ – prefixed conjunction wa (and) + ACC – accusative particle inna + PRON – 2nd person masculine singular object pronoun ka
Root Link: ا ن ن
latadʿūhum
certainly call them
EMPH – emphatic prefix lam + V – 2nd person masculine singular imperfect verb + PRON – 3rd person masculine plural object pronoun Ha
Root Link: د ع و
ilā
to
P – preposition
Root Link: ا ل ى
ṣirāṭin
(the) Path
N – genitive masculine indefinite noun
Root Link: ص ر ط
mus'taqīmin
Straight
N – genitive masculine indefinite (form X) active participle
Root Link: ق و م
